Transpacific Ocean Freight Rates Surge Over 100% as Shippers Frontload Cargo Ahead of New Tariffs
Ocean freight rates from Asia to the U.S. have doubled since mid-May as retailers rush to import holiday inventory early to outrun expected federal trade tariffs. The massive pull-forward of cargo has compressed the traditional peak shipping season into early summer, forcing carriers to tightly manage vessel capacity.

Why it matters
By pulling holiday inventory into the summer months, retailers are locking in their costs before new tariffs hit—meaning the prices consumers pay this winter are being decided by the shipping maneuvers happening right now.
When ocean freight rates double in a matter of weeks, the immediate assumption is a catastrophic breakdown in the global supply chain, reminiscent of the gridlock seen in recent years. But the mid-2026 surge in transpacific shipping costs is not a malfunction—it is a deliberate, highly coordinated defensive maneuver by global retailers. Spot rates from Asia to the U.S. West Coast have climbed past $6,200 per forty-foot equivalent unit (FEU), representing a staggering 120% increase since mid-May, while East Coast rates have pushed firmly into the $8,000 to $9,500 range. Rather than a sign of systemic failure, this pricing spike reflects a proactive strategy by importers to secure their supply lines before external pressures make shipping even more unpredictable.[1][2]
The primary catalyst for this sudden and dramatic spike is a logistics strategy known across the industry as 'frontloading.' Anticipating a new regime of federal trade tariffs and expected July bunker fuel surcharges, major importers are rushing to bring their autumn and winter inventory into the United States months ahead of their normal schedules. By pulling these shipments forward, procurement teams are effectively buying insurance against the unknown, trading higher immediate freight costs for long-term inventory security and price predictability.[1][5]
By compressing the traditional third-quarter peak shipping season into the early weeks of summer, shippers are attempting to outrun the regulatory clock before new trade policies take effect. This massive pull-forward activity has fundamentally altered the supply-and-demand calculus on the transpacific trade lane. What is normally a steady, predictable ramp-up in cargo volume has been transformed into an immediate, high-stakes scramble for vessel space, forcing companies to compete aggressively for limited container slots on outbound ships from Asia.[5][6]
The mechanics of this surge reveal the deeply interconnected nature of modern maritime infrastructure. As demand for cargo slots spikes, ocean carriers have actively managed their available capacity to maintain their newfound pricing power. Rather than flooding the market with extra vessels to absorb the sudden volume, major shipping alliances have executed a series of 'blank sailings'—deliberately canceling scheduled voyages to keep space tight, ensure ships depart fully loaded, and guarantee that general rate increases hold firm across the market.[3][5]
In a single week in late May, carriers announced eight blank sailings on the transpacific route, signaling a disciplined approach to capacity management. This strategy ensures that vessels operate at maximum profitability for the shipping lines, while simultaneously forcing shippers to accept premium spot rates just to guarantee their cargo makes it onto the water. The dynamic creates a highly competitive booking environment where standard contracts are frequently bypassed in favor of immediate, higher-paying spot market transactions.[3][5]
This aggressive capacity management has led to a sharp increase in what the industry calls 'rollover' rates. When a vessel is overbooked, lower-paying or later-booked containers are systematically rolled to the next available departure. Depending on the carrier and the specific service lane, rollover levels have recently reached between 30% and 60%. This high degree of uncertainty requires procurement teams to build significant buffer time into their transit schedules, further incentivizing them to ship goods as early as possible.[5]
This localized capacity management is heavily compounded by external geographic pressures affecting the broader maritime network. The ongoing security-driven rerouting of commercial vessels away from the Red Sea and around the Cape of Good Hope has absorbed roughly 2.5 million twenty-foot equivalent units (TEU) of global shipping capacity. The extended transit times required to navigate around the African continent tie up vessels and equipment for weeks longer than traditional Suez Canal routings would demand, effectively shrinking the active global fleet.[6]

While that massive diversion primarily affects the Asia-to-Europe trade lane, the global shipping fleet operates as a closed, highly interconnected system. Ships that are tied up on longer African routes cannot be easily or quickly repositioned to the Pacific Ocean to relieve the frontloading pressure. This lack of fungible capacity leaves the transpacific lane highly sensitive to sudden demand shocks, as carriers simply do not have the spare vessels required to deploy extra loaders and ease the current bottleneck.[6]
Regional weather events have further constrained the logistics system right at the point of origin. A series of severe mid-summer typhoons in the Yangtze and Pearl River deltas forced temporary closures and operational slowdowns at some of China's largest export hubs. These weather-related delays created localized backlogs, disrupting the delicate choreography of port operations and preventing empty containers from cycling back into the loading rotation at the exact moment demand was peaking, adding physical friction to an already strained network.[3][4]
The resulting equipment shortages meant that even when vessel space was technically available, shippers occasionally struggled to find the physical steel boxes needed to move their goods. This mismatch between available cargo, available containers, and available ship slots highlights the fragility of the physical supply chain, where a disruption in one node—such as a storm in the South China Sea—cascades rapidly into pricing premiums and delayed departures for importers halfway across the globe, forcing logistics managers to constantly adapt.[3][4]
The cargo mix itself is also shifting in response to these broader economic trends. While traditional retail goods and seasonal apparel make up the bulk of the frontloaded volume, analysts note that a surge in high-value technology shipments has fundamentally altered the baseline demand. Specifically, the rapid export of hardware supporting the global expansion of artificial intelligence infrastructure has provided a high-margin, consistent baseline of demand that keeps container floors full even when consumer goods shipments fluctuate.[4]

Once the cargo finally arrives in North America, the domestic infrastructure must immediately absorb the early influx of goods. Ports in Los Angeles and Long Beach have reported double-digit year-over-year volume increases, successfully processing the advanced shipments as they arrive. Unlike the crippling vessel queues and offshore parking lots seen during previous supply chain crises, the current port operations remain remarkably fluid, demonstrating that the coastal infrastructure has matured and adapted to handle sudden volume spikes without breaking down.[1]
With the ports functioning smoothly, the primary logistical challenge has instead shifted inland. Because the inventory is arriving months before it is actually needed for the holiday shopping season, retailers must secure massive amounts of warehouse space to store the goods. Companies are willingly trading higher domestic storage costs for lower international tariff exposure, viewing the expense of holding inventory in the United States for an extra three to four months as a necessary cost of doing business in a volatile trade environment.[1][5]
Environmental regulations are also playing a quiet but substantial role in the elevated rate environment. Stricter maritime fuel standards and international carbon levies have permanently increased the baseline cost of operating a modern container ship. Carriers pass these mandatory compliance costs directly to shippers through 'Green Shipping' surcharges and elevated Bunker Adjustment Factors, ensuring that the absolute cost floor of ocean freight remains high regardless of underlying consumer demand, seasonal fluctuations, or temporary dips in cargo volume.[6]

For the broader economy, this massive frontloading wave acts as a critical shock absorber. By securing their inventory now at elevated but known freight rates, retailers are locking in their landed costs before the new tariff structures and late-year surcharges take effect. This proactive approach allows businesses to finalize their pricing models for the upcoming holiday season with a high degree of certainty, insulating their profit margins from the unpredictable swings of international trade policy and geopolitical instability.[1][6]
While shipping a container across the Pacific is currently much more expensive than it was in the spring, the strategy successfully shields consumer goods from the compounding volatility of late-year regulatory changes. It demonstrates the proactive resilience of the modern supply chain: companies are willingly absorbing a short-term pricing hit to guarantee long-term inventory stability, ensuring that the products consumers rely on will be waiting on the shelves when they are needed most, regardless of what happens on the global stage.[5][6]

Where opinion splits
Global Importers & Retailers
Prioritizing inventory security and cost predictability over immediate freight savings.
For major retailers, the sudden doubling of spot rates is a calculated trade-off. By paying a premium to move cargo in June and July, procurement teams are effectively buying insurance against the unknown. The strategy locks in landed costs before new federal tariffs take effect and guarantees that holiday inventory is physically resting in domestic warehouses, insulating consumer goods from late-year geopolitical shocks or sudden capacity crunches.
Ocean Carriers
Utilizing capacity management to maintain pricing power and offset operational friction.
Shipping lines view the current rate environment as a necessary stabilization after periods of extreme volatility. By executing blank sailings and strictly managing vessel space, carriers are ensuring that ships do not sail half-empty. This disciplined approach to capacity helps alliances offset the compounding costs of stricter environmental compliance, elevated bunker fuel prices, and the massive operational expense of rerouting fleets around the Cape of Good Hope.
Supply Chain Analysts
Observing a maturing, highly adaptable logistics network that absorbs shocks without breaking.
Industry observers note a stark contrast between the 2026 frontloading wave and the supply chain crises of the early 2020s. While rates are elevated, the physical infrastructure is holding up. Ports are processing double-digit volume increases without catastrophic vessel queues, and the system is demonstrating a proactive resilience. Analysts argue that this controlled stress proves the global supply chain has evolved from a fragile, just-in-time model to a more robust, just-in-case framework.
Key terms
- Frontloading
- The strategic acceleration of orders and shipments to bring inventory into a country before a specific deadline, such as a new tariff implementation.
- Blank Sailing
- The deliberate cancellation of a scheduled port call or entire voyage by an ocean carrier to manage capacity and support freight rates.
- FEU
- Forty-foot Equivalent Unit; a standard measure of volume in ocean shipping, representing one 40-foot shipping container.
- Rollover Rate
- The percentage of cargo that is bumped from its scheduled vessel to a later departure due to overbooking or capacity constraints.
- Bunker Adjustment Factor (BAF)
- A floating surcharge added to ocean freight rates to compensate carriers for fluctuations in fuel prices.

Reader questions
What is frontloading in shipping?
Frontloading is the practice of importing goods months ahead of their normal schedule to avoid upcoming tariffs, price increases, or peak season bottlenecks.
Why are ocean freight rates rising in 2026?
Rates are surging due to a combination of tariff-driven frontloading, early peak season demand, carrier capacity management, and ongoing vessel rerouting away from the Red Sea.
What is a blank sailing?
A blank sailing occurs when an ocean carrier deliberately cancels a scheduled voyage to keep vessel space tight and maintain higher freight rates.
How does the Red Sea disruption affect transpacific shipping?
While the Red Sea primarily impacts Asia-Europe routes, it absorbs millions of containers of global capacity, preventing those ships from being moved to the Pacific to relieve demand.
